English Toy Spaniel versus Shih Tzu: Overview

A very important difference between the English Toy Spaniel and the Shih Tzu is the size difference between the two dog breeds. The English Toy Spaniel is a small-sized dog while the Shih Tzu is a tiny-sized dog.

Furthermore, both the English Toy Spaniel and the Shih Tzu are Companion Dogs. This means both the English Toy Spaniel and the Shih Tzu were bred to be companions for humans. Their main goal in life is to be with people, and they will be very sad if left to themselves for long hours day after day.

  • Size (Weight and Height) of English Toy Spaniel versus Shih Tzu

    Now, let us discuss the difference in size between the English Toy Spaniel and the Shih Tzu.

    English Toy Spaniels weigh 8 to 14 pounds when fully grown. English Toy Spaniels are 10 to 11 inches tall at the shoulder when fully grown.

    On the other hand, Shih Tzus weigh 9 to 16 pounds when fully grown. Shih Tzus are 9 to 10 inches tall at the shoulder when fully grown.

    Price of English Toy Spaniel versus Price of Shih Tzu

    The average price of the English Toy Spaniel puppy is $2350. The price of the English Toy Spaniel typically ranges from $2250 – $2525. However, the price of a English Toy Spaniel can be as low as $2000 and as high as $2550. We obtained this price information by reviewing the prices of 3 English Toy Spaniel puppies listed for sale from various sources.

    The average price of the Shih Tzu puppy is $1820. The price of the Shih Tzu typically ranges from $1200 – $2300. However, the price of a Shih Tzu can be as low as $200 and as high as $5850. We obtained this price information by collecting and reviewing the prices of 806 Shih Tzu puppies listed for sale from various sources.

    The English Toy Spaniel is more expensive than the Shih Tzu.

    The Popularity of English Toy Spaniel versus Popularity of Shih Tzu

    Every year, the American Kennel Club (AKC) publishes information on how popular a dog breed is in that particular year. The AKC gets the popularity information of a breed from how many dogs of that breed the owners register with the AKC every year. The AKC collects this data for about 200 dog breeds. The AKC collects this data for purebred dogs only(no mixed or hybrid dogs).

    The graphs and the table below show the popularity of the English Toy Spaniel and the Shih Tzu over the years.

    Based on the AKC popularity data over the years, the Shih Tzu is more popular with dog owners than the English Toy Spaniel. This is because, over the years, the average popularity of the Shih Tzu is 18 out of about 200 dog breeds while the average popularity of the English Toy Spaniel is 134 out of about 200 dog breeds.
